Vol de Nuit (ヴォル・ドゥ・ニュイ Voru du Nyui?, Fra: "Night Flight") is one of Larxene's weapons in Kingdom Hearts 358/2 Days; its upgrade, Vol de Nuit+, is her most powerful weapon. To wield the Vol de Nuit set of knives, Larxene must have the Pandora Gear attached.

Design

A Vol de Nuit knife's blade is shaped like a large, gold arrowhead. The blae has three holes in it; two circular ones near the top, and one lens-shaped one near the base, The inner edges of these holes are black. The shaft of the blade is pale yellow and the handle is vaguely shaped like a four-pointed star. The bottom three spikes are yellow. There is a thin, blue line just above the handle, and an even thinner, brown line just above that.

Etymology

Vol de Nuit is the name of a book from the French author Antoine de Saint Exupéry, in which a flier is trapped in a storm.
